--书中总结而来1.数据操作:在IO包中,且与平台无关数据流,包括数据输入流(DataInputStream)和数据输出(DataOutputStream).2.压缩:经常用到WinZip和WinRar,zip是一种常用压缩格式,需导入java.util.zip包,可以用此包中Zip,ZipOutputStream,ZipInputStream,ZipEntry几个类完成操作。3.字节
Java,可以从不同角度进行分类。按照数据流方向不同可以分为:输入流和输出。按照处理数据单位不同可以分为:字节流和字符。按照实现功能不同可以分为:节点和处理。输出:输入流:因此输入和输出都是从程序角度来说。字节流:一次读入或读出是8位二进制。字符:一次读入或读出是16位二进制。字节流和字符原理是相同,只不过处理单位不同而已。后缀是Stream是字节流,而后缀是Re
转载 2023-09-29 09:38:02
265阅读
/Stream是在JAVA8中引入一个抽象,可以处理类似SQL语句声明数据。 例如,考虑下面的SQL语句。SELECT max(salary),employee_id,employee_name FROM Employee上面的SQL表达式会自动返回最大薪水员工细节,没有对开发者最终做任何计算。在Java中使用集合框架,开发人员必须使用循环,使检查反复。另一个值得关注是效率,多核处理器可
数据流基本概念几乎所有的程序都离不开信息输入和输出,比如从键盘读取数据,从文件中获取或者向文件中存入数据,在显示器上显示数据。这些情况下都会涉及有关输入/输出处理。在Java中,把这些不同类型输入、输出源抽象为(Stream),其中输入或输出数据称为数据流(Data Stream),用统一接口来表示。即数据在两设备间传输称为本质是数据传输,根据数据传输特性将抽象为各种类,
转载 2023-07-21 15:32:01
779阅读
Java语言有哪些特点1、简单易学、有丰富类库2、面向对象(Java最重要特性,让程序耦合度更低,内聚性更高)3、与平台无关性(JVM是Java跨平台使用根本)4、可靠安全5、支持多线程面向对象和面向过程区别面向过程: 是分析解决问题步骤,然后用函数把这些步骤一步一步地实现,然后在使用时候一一调用则可。性能较高,所以单片机、嵌入式开发等一般采用面向过程开发面向对象: 是把构成问题事务
Java 中数据流:  对于某问题:将一个 long 类型数据写到文件中,有办法吗?    转字符串 → 通过 getbytes() 写进去,费劲,而且在此过程中 long 类型数需要不断地转换.      现在,Java 中数据流能够很好解决这个问
转载 2017-05-02 21:52:00
132阅读
Java IO基础总结Java中使用IO(输入输出)来读取和写入,根据数据走向可分为输入流和输出,用户可以从输入流中中读取信息,但不能写它,相反,对输出,只能往输入流写,而不能读它(输入流表示从一个源读取数据,输出表示向一个目标写数据)。Java.io包中几乎包含了所有操作输入、输出需要类,所有这些类代表了输入源和输出目标。IO分类根据处理数据类型不同分为:字符和字节流根据数据流
目录数据流一、内容回顾(一)Java数据流分类(二) Java数据流功能与使用二、典型实例三、实验设计(一)实验一(二)实验二(三)实验三(四)实验四数据流一、内容回顾是一组有顺序,有起点和终点字节集合,是对数据传输总称或抽象。本质是数据传输,Java根据数据传输特性将抽象为各种类。在这一部分将简要介绍Java数据流分类以及常见Java数据流功能和用法 。(一)Java数据流
转载 2023-08-23 18:57:37
0阅读
数据流不熟悉,各层流包装常常把我弄糊涂,翻阅API也不是很方便理清其结构,所以总结一下基础知识点吧。介绍 数据流(Stream)是一组有顺序、有起点和终点字节集合,是对输入和输出总称和抽象。划分及简单描述数据流一般分为输入流(InputStream)和输出(OutputStream)。 输入流只能读不能写,而输出只能写不能读。Java主要定义了两种类型:字节流和字符。 字节流
转载 2023-07-19 11:08:14
85阅读
数据流数据流图是描述数据处理过程工具含义 数据流图从数据传递和加工角度,以图形方式刻画数据流从输入到输出传输变换过程。数据流图是结构化系统分析主要工具,他表示了系统内部信息流向,并表示了系统逻辑处理功能。  特性抽象性概括性层次性   数据流用途 系统分析员用这种工具可以自顶向下分析系统信息流程。可在图上画出需要计算机处理部分。根据数据存贮,进一步做数
转载 2024-06-30 12:43:38
44阅读
在此,分享一下自己学习JAVA学习心得。有不对地方请帮忙改正,也希望对想学java同学有帮助!JAVA基础        —IO   IO流体系图: IO概述:1)IO流用来处理设备之间数据传输        上传文件和下载文件   2)Java数据操作是通过
什么是I/O所谓I/O(Input/Output缩写),即指应用程序对数据在设备或者文件上输入与输出。是一组有顺序,有起点和终点字节集合,是对数据传输总称或抽象(java万物皆对象特性)。即数据在两设备间传输称为本质是数据传输,根据数据传输特性将抽象为各种类,方便更直观进行数据操作。数据流是一串连续不断数据集合,数据写入程序可以是一段一段地向数据流管道中写入数据
Java高级I/O-缓冲数据流以及对象 前言:通过前面的学习,已经学完了Java基本Java有字节流和字符两大类,而每一种都有对应输入和输出; 1、字节流 1.1字节输入流-主要是:FileInputStream   1.2字节输出-主要是:FileOutputStream 2、字符 2.1字符输入流-主要是:FileReader 2.2字符
数据流是指一组有顺序、有起点和终点字节集合。被组织成不同层次,如下图所示。按照最粗略分法,数据流可以分为输入数据流(input stream)和输出数据流(output stream)。输入数据流只能读不能写,而输出数据流只能写不能读。显而易见,从数据流中读取数据时,从数据流中读取数据时,必须有一个数据源与该数据流相连。在java开发环境中,java.io包为用户提供了几乎所有常用数据
转载 2023-08-31 19:11:57
80阅读
第14周 预习、实验与作业:Java数据库编程 回想“与文件”章节,如何将一组对象存储到文件中?主要步骤是什么。把数据抽象为,用字节输入输出(InputStream,OutputStream)进行读写。 主要步骤为:创建一个输入流,通过该写入文件public static void writeObjectToFile(Object obj) { Fil
转载 2023-07-17 16:45:14
34阅读
1.信息系统建设按其生命周期可依次分为总体规划阶段、系统分析阶段、系统设计阶段、系统实施与运维阶段等。2.数据流图(DFD)是一种便于用户理解、分析系统数据流图形工具,是软件系统分析阶段用于描述系统逻辑模型图形描述工具,用于回答软件系统“做什么”问题,它摆脱了系统物理内容,精确地在逻辑上描述系统功能、输入、输出和数据存储等,是系统逻辑模型重要组成部分。3.数据流图从数据传递和加工
概念:在程序开发中IO核心就是:输入和输出。输入和输出是相对,可能来自不同环境。 对于服务器或者是客户端而言,传递就是一种数据流处理形式,而所谓数据流就是字节数据。这种处理形式在java.io包里提供了两类支持:  - 字节处理:OutputStream(输出字节流)、InputStream(输入字节流)  - 字符处理:Writer(输出
IO简介数据流是一组有序,有起点和终点字节数据序列。包括输入流和输出序列中数据既可以是未经加工原始二进制数据,也可以是经一定编码处理后符合某种格式规定特定数据。因 此Java分为两种: 1) 字节流:数据流中最小数据单元是字节 2) 字符数据流中最小数据单元是字符, Java字符是Unicode编码,一个字符占用两个字节。 Java.io包中最重要就是5个类和
作者:逸风如梦数据流:(package:java.io) 数据流分为输入流(inputStrean)和输出(outputStream)。输入流只能从中读取数据,而不能向其去写入数据。输出只能向其写入数据,而不能从中读取数据。1、字节流类InputStream和OutputStream是两个抽象类,InputStream包括了字节输入流所有方法,OutputStream包括了字符输出所有方法
HDFS写数据流程客户端通过分布式文件系统(Distributed FileSystem) 模块向namenode请求上传文件,namenode检查目标文件是否已存在,父目录是否存在namenode返回是否可以上传客户端请求第一个block上传到哪几个datanode服务器上namenode返回3个datanode节点,分别是dn1,dn2,dn3客户端通过FSDataOutput...
原创 2021-06-04 19:18:01
718阅读
  • 1
  • 2
  • 3
  • 4
  • 5